Forums | Admin

Discussion Forums: open-discussion

Start New Thread Start New Thread
Message: 10828
BY: Daniel Berger (djberg96)
DATE: 2006-07-07 20:28
SUBJECT: Warnings from Sun Studio 11 compiler

 

Hi,

I built ruby-oci8-0.1.15 alright on Solaris 10 with the Sun Studio 11 compiler, but I thought these warnings might interest you:

"env.c", line 212: warning: assignment type mismatch:
pointer to unsigned char "=" pointer to char
"env.c", line 213: warning: assignment type mismatch:
pointer to unsigned char "=" pointer to char
"env.c", line 214: warning: assignment type mismatch:
pointer to unsigned char "=" pointer to char
"error.c", line 33: warning: argument #4 is incompatible with prototype:
prototype: pointer to signed int : "/opt/oracle/rdbms/demo/ociap.h", line 6367
argument : pointer to unsigned int
"error.c", line 38: warning: argument #1 is incompatible with prototype:
prototype: pointer to const char : "/usr/include/iso/string_iso.h", line 69
argument : pointer to unsigned char
"error.c", line 46: warning: argument #1 is incompatible with prototype:
prototype: pointer to const char : "/opt/test/lib/ruby/1.8/sparc-solaris2.10/intern.h", line 396
argument : pointer to unsigned char
"error.c", line 75: warning: argument #1 is incompatible with prototype:
prototype: pointer to const char : "/opt/test/lib/ruby/1.8/sparc-solaris2.10/intern.h", line 395
argument : pointer to unsigned char
"svcctx.c", line 76: warning: assignment type mismatch:
pointer to unsigned char "=" pointer to char
"svcctx.c", line 77: warning: assignment type mismatch:
pointer to unsigned char "=" pointer to char
"svcctx.c", line 78: warning: assignment type mismatch:
pointer to unsigned char "=" pointer to char
"svcctx.c", line 160: warning: assignment type mismatch:
pointer to unsigned char "=" pointer to char
"server.c", line 43: warning: assignment type mismatch:
pointer to unsigned char "=" pointer to char
"server.c", line 120: warning: argument #1 is incompatible with prototype:
prototype: pointer to const char : "/opt/test/lib/ruby/1.8/sparc-solaris2.10/intern.h", line 396
argument : pointer to unsigned char
"stmt.c", line 150: warning: assignment type mismatch:
pointer to unsigned char "=" pointer to char
"stmt.c", line 409: warning: assignment type mismatch:
pointer to unsigned char "=" pointer to char
"stmt.c", line 521: warning: argument #4 is incompatible with prototype:
prototype: pointer to signed int : "/opt/oracle/rdbms/demo/ociap.h", line 6367
argument : pointer to unsigned int
"bind.c", line 82: warning: argument #1 is incompatible with prototype:
prototype: pointer to const char : "/opt/test/lib/ruby/1.8/sparc-solaris2.10/intern.h", line 70
argument : pointer to unsigned char
"describe.c", line 68: warning: assignment type mismatch:
pointer to unsigned char "=" pointer to char
"lob.c", line 172: warning: assignment type mismatch:
pointer to unsigned char "=" pointer to char
"oranumber.c", line 72: warning: argument #1 is incompatible with prototype:
prototype: pointer to const char : "/opt/test/lib/ruby/1.8/sparc-solaris2.10/intern.h", line 70
argument : pointer to unsigned char
"oranumber.c", line 86: warning: argument #1 is incompatible with prototype:
prototype: pointer to const char : "/opt/test/lib/ruby/1.8/sparc-solaris2.10/intern.h", line 322
argument : pointer to unsigned char
"oranumber.c", line 101: warning: argument #1 is incompatible with prototype:
prototype: pointer to const char : "/opt/test/lib/ruby/1.8/sparc-solaris2.10/intern.h", line 395
argument : pointer to unsigned char
"ocinumber.c", line 48: warning: assignment type mismatch:
pointer to unsigned char "=" pointer to char
"ocinumber.c", line 51: warning: assignment type mismatch:
pointer to unsigned char "=" pointer to char
"ocinumber.c", line 56: warning: assignment type mismatch:
pointer to unsigned char "=" pointer to char
"ocinumber.c", line 64: warning: assignment type mismatch:
pointer to unsigned char "=" pointer to char
"ocinumber.c", line 67: warning: argument #2 is incompatible with prototype:
prototype: pointer to const unsigned char : "/opt/oracle/rdbms/demo/orl.h", line 963
argument : pointer to char
"attr.c", line 242: warning: argument #1 is incompatible with prototype:
prototype: pointer to const char : "/opt/test/lib/ruby/1.8/sparc-solaris2.10/intern.h", line 395
argument : pointer to unsigned char
"attr.c", line 278: warning: argument #1 is incompatible with prototype:
prototype: pointer to const char : "/opt/test/lib/ruby/1.8/sparc-solaris2.10/intern.h", line 70
argument : pointer to unsigned char

Regards,

Dan


Thread View

Thread Author Date
Warnings from Sun Studio 11 compilerDaniel Berger2006-07-07 20:28

Post a followup to this message